引言
随着人工智能技术的飞速发展,大模型产品在全球范围内迅速崛起。这些基于深度学习的大型语言模型,不仅为各行各业带来了颠覆性的变革,同时也引发了对于其开发背后的秘密与挑战的广泛讨论。本文将深入探讨全球大模型产品的加速开发过程,揭示其背后的技术、机遇与挑战。
一、大模型产品的定义与特点
1. 定义
大模型产品,通常指的是那些参数规模达到亿级以上的深度学习模型,如GPT-3、BERT等。它们具备强大的学习和推理能力,能够处理复杂的自然语言任务,如文本生成、翻译、摘要等。
2. 特点
- 规模庞大:大模型通常拥有数十亿甚至数百亿个参数,需要大量的数据进行训练。
- 计算密集:大模型的训练过程对计算资源要求极高,通常需要高性能的GPU集群。
- 泛化能力强:大模型能够处理多种类型的自然语言任务,具有广泛的适用性。
二、大模型产品的开发过程
1. 数据收集与预处理
大模型产品的开发首先需要对海量数据进行收集和预处理。这包括数据的清洗、标注、去重等步骤,以确保数据的质量和多样性。
2. 模型设计
模型设计是开发大模型产品的关键步骤,包括选择合适的神经网络架构、优化模型参数等。
3. 训练与优化
训练过程是计算密集型的,需要大量的计算资源和时间。优化过程则旨在提高模型的性能和泛化能力。
4. 部署与应用
训练完成后,模型将被部署到服务器或云平台,以供实际应用。
三、大模型产品加速开发的秘密
1. 云计算技术
云计算技术的发展为大模型产品的加速开发提供了强大的基础设施支持。通过使用云服务,开发者可以轻松地获取高性能的计算资源和存储空间。
2. 优化算法
不断优化的算法和模型架构,如Transformer架构,使得大模型产品的开发更加高效。
3. 跨学科合作
大模型产品的开发需要涉及多个学科领域,如计算机科学、统计学、语言学等。跨学科的合作有助于推动大模型产品的创新。
四、大模型产品开发的挑战
1. 计算资源需求
大模型产品的训练需要大量的计算资源,这导致了高昂的运行成本。
2. 数据隐私与安全
大模型产品的开发和应用涉及到大量敏感数据,如何保障数据隐私和安全是一个重要挑战。
3. 模型可解释性
大模型产品的决策过程通常非常复杂,难以解释。如何提高模型的可解释性是一个亟待解决的问题。
五、结语
全球大模型产品的加速开发,既带来了前所未有的机遇,也伴随着一系列挑战。只有不断突破技术瓶颈,才能让大模型产品更好地服务于人类社会。